Get Ready for Bike & Roll to School Week

San Francisco’s 2017 Bike & Roll to School Week is April 17-21. Sign up your school before April 1!

The annual celebration of fun, healthy ways to arrive at schools across our city is coming up, so it’s time to see how and where to get involved. Bike & Roll to School Week welcomes anyone and everyone with wheels! It’s time to get out your bicycles, skateboards, wheelchairs, rollerskates and strollers. Any San Francisco school, from pre-k to high school, is invited to participate in the fun. Last year over 80 schools and thousands of children were a part of Bike & Roll to School Week. This is a great opportunity to try biking to school, if you haven’t done it before. Everyone from students, to teachers and even baby siblings are invited to join in. Not quite sure how to ride, or aren’t that confident? Don’t let that hold you back. There will be a series of free Family Biking Workshops, hosted by Safe Routes to School, at playgrounds around you. These workshops will be from 11:00 am – 2:00 pm, at the locations listed below.

Feb 11 BAYVIEW: Bret Harte Elementary. Fun for the family. Healthy snacks provided
Feb 26 BALBOA PARK: Denman Middle School/hosted by SF Shared Schoolyard Project. Fun for the whole family. Free lunch.
Mar 11 PORTOLA: E.R. Taylor Elementary School
Mar 18 WESTERN ADDITION: Rosa Parks Elementary
Mar 25 Location TBA
Apr 8 SUNSET: Lawton Alternative School
Apr 15 Jose Ortega Elementary: Safety Fair hosted by Assemblymember Phil Ting
Apr 17-21 San Francisco Bike & Roll to School Week
Apr 22 CHINATOWN: Joe Di Maggio Playground
May 20 RICHMOND DISTRICT: Argonne Elementary
